Ubuntu定时器如何加密
在Ubuntu系统中为定时任务加把“锁”
在Ubuntu环境下,当你需要执行一些包含敏感操作的定时任务时,直接使用明文cron作业可能会带来安全风险。那么,如何为这些定时器加上一层可靠的加密保护呢?下面这几种思路,或许能给你提供清晰的路径。
免费影视、动漫、音乐、游戏、小说资源长期稳定更新! 👉 点此立即查看 👈

1. 从源头加密:处理Shell脚本
最直接的思路,就是对你实际要执行的命令本身进行加密。具体可以分三步走:
编写脚本:首先,像平常一样,把需要定时执行的命令写进一个Shell脚本文件里。
#!/bin/bash echo "执行加密任务..." # 这里放置你的加密命令加密文件:接下来,使用GPG这类成熟的加密工具对这个脚本文件进行加密。比如,使用AES256算法可以这样操作:
gpg --symmetric --cipher-algo AES256 your_script.sh命令执行后,你会得到一个加密后的新文件
your_script.sh.gpg,原始的脚本文件就可以安全删除了。在Cron中解密执行:最后,在cron配置里,任务就变成了“先解密,再执行”。一条命令就能搞定:
* * * * * gpg --decrypt your_script.sh.gpg | bash这样,cron表里存放的只是解密指令,真正的业务逻辑被锁在了加密文件里。
2. 加密Cron作业本身
如果觉得加密脚本文件还不够,你甚至可以尝试加密cron作业的整条命令。这种方法稍微绕一点,但思路很有趣。
准备加密命令:将需要定时执行的完整命令,先加密成一个文件。
echo "echo '执行加密任务...' | gpg --symmetric --cipher-algo AES256" > encrypted_cron_job.gpg借助`at`命令执行:在cron中,通过管道将解密命令传递给
at命令来即时执行。cron条目看起来会像这样:* * * * * echo "gpg --decrypt /path/to/encrypted_cron_job.gpg | bash" | at now这相当于cron只负责触发一个“解密并提交任务”的动作,真正的执行由
at调度完成。
3. 借助专业工具管理
除了手动组合系统命令,市面上也有一些工具和服务能简化加密定时任务的管理:
- Cronitor:这是一个功能更全面的在线服务,除了监控cron作业的健康状态,也提供了对作业命令进行安全管理的功能,可以作为考虑选项。
- Anacron:对于非24小时开机的桌面系统,Anacron是个不错的补充。它本身不直接提供加密,但你可以将其与上述加密脚本的方法结合,来管理那些错过执行时间的加密任务。
需要警惕的几个关键点
无论采用哪种方案,下面这几个原则必须牢记,否则加密就形同虚设:
- 密钥安全是根本:加密密钥(或密码)的保存位置必须绝对安全,绝不能和加密文件放在一起,或者以明文形式写在任何脚本里。
- 选择强加密算法:像AES256这类目前被公认为强健的算法,是推荐的选择,避免使用过时或已被证明脆弱的算法。
- 保持系统和工具更新:定期更新你的GPG工具套件和操作系统,以确保没有已知的安全漏洞会危及你的加密体系。
总的来说,在Ubuntu中为定时任务加密,核心思路无非是“将敏感部分隐藏起来”。无论是加密脚本内容,还是加密执行命令,都能有效提升任务的安全性。选择哪一种,就看你更倾向于管理文件的便利性,还是追求整个流程的隐蔽性了。
游乐网为非赢利性网站,所展示的游戏/软件/文章内容均来自于互联网或第三方用户上传分享,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系youleyoucom@outlook.com。
同类文章
如何利用Debian exploit漏洞进行安全测试
利用系统漏洞和进行渗透测试是违法行为,只有在合法授权的情况下才可进行。因此,我无法为您提供关于如何利用Debian exploit漏洞进行安全测试的指导。 安全测试的合法途径 那么,如果目标是发现并修复风险,有哪些合规的路径可走呢?关键在于获得授权。 授权渗透测试:这是最直接有效的方式。在获得目标组
Debian exploit漏洞的最新动态
关于“Debian Exploit漏洞”的探讨与安全实践参考 最近在技术社区里,偶尔会看到有人讨论所谓“Debian Exploit漏洞”的具体情况。坦率地说,目前公开的、可信的渠道并没有关于这个特定命名漏洞的详细信息。这本身也提醒我们,在面对各种安全传闻时,核查信源至关重要。不过,借此机会,我们正
Debian exploit漏洞的修复步骤
修复Debian系统中的Exploit漏洞通常涉及以下几个步骤 面对系统安全漏洞,尤其是那些可能被利用的Exploit,及时、正确地修复是运维工作的重中之重。对于Debian用户而言,一套清晰、可操作的修复流程能极大降低风险。下面,我们就来梳理一下常规的处理步骤。 1 更新系统 一切安全加固的起点
Debian系统如何抵御exploit攻击
Debian系统抵御exploit攻击的核心措施 面对层出不穷的exploit攻击,加固Debian系统并非难事,关键在于构建一套从基础到进阶的防御体系。下面这十个层面的措施,可以说是构建安全防线的标准动作。 1 保持系统更新 这几乎是所有安全建议的起点,但也是最容易被忽视的一点。定期更新系统,意
Debian exploit漏洞的影响范围
关于“Debian exploit”的具体信息 目前,关于“Debian exploit”这一具体漏洞的公开信息尚不明确。不过,我们可以借此机会深入了解一下Debian系统本身及其一整套成熟的安全防护机制。毕竟,知己知彼,方能百战不殆。 Debian系统概述 简单来说,Debian是一个完全自由、以
- 日榜
- 周榜
- 月榜
1
2
3
4
5
6
7
8
9
10
1
2
3
4
5
6
7
8
9
10
相关攻略
2015-03-10 11:25
2015-03-10 11:05
2021-08-04 13:30
2015-03-10 11:22
2015-03-10 12:39
2022-05-16 18:57
2025-05-23 13:43
2025-05-23 14:01
热门教程
- 游戏攻略
- 安卓教程
- 苹果教程
- 电脑教程
热门话题

